Salton Link is in Emerson Valley, Milton Keynes and in Milton Keynes district. MK4 2LF is located in the Shenley Brook End elect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Milton Keynes South. This postcode has been in use since 1996-06-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Salton Link was 30.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 47.0% lower than the Bletchley West average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Salton Link has the 11th lowest crime rate of 52 local areas in Bletchley West and the 184th lowest crime rate of 855 local areas in Milton Keynes .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 15.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-75.8%.
